"From the outside the red rusticated facade and a restored vintage car hint at Paragon 700’s theatrical interior, where founders Pascale Lauber and Ulrike Bauschke have unleashed a wildly imaginative design vision: Baroque-meets-Tim Burton baroque theatrics, macabre monkey statues and reinterpreted Renaissance works sit alongside artist-designed sofas and more restrained, fresco-ceilinged guest rooms. The underground spa—built into caves and accessed by a glass elevator—offers hydromassage, a Turkish bath, a Himalayan salt wall and a natural whirlpool, while the hotel’s sustainability commitments (micro‑CHP, zero plastics, local materials) and its prime Ostuni location make it a perfect base to return to for a dip, an offbeat cocktail and dinner at Restaurant 700." - Liam Hess
